Hi all,

My frame number is gk76a-104062 what model is that and in turn, which cdi does that require? The current blown up cdi has no sticker on it! I've looked all over the forum and have found conflicting info.

Looks like you have a 91 model. I'm not sure if standard or SP

If single plug on CDI:
SP 91 32900-33C40

If dual plug (standard) here are the numbers:
32900-33C10 1990
32900-33C70 91-92
32900-35D30 93 (beginning of restriction)
32900-35D31 94

I have a 90 and 91 plate 76 and both Cdi's run both bikes fine even tho they are different part numbers I have the 33C10 & 33C70 part numbers non sp twin plug if that's any help for you trying to get hold of one
